    RemoteIoT's Virtual Private Cloud (VPC) solution provides a secure and isolated network environment for managing IoT devices. The VPC architecture allows users to create a private network space where they can deploy and manage their devices without exposing them directly to the public internet. This approach significantly enhances security while maintaining the flexibility of remote access.

    The Secure Shell (SSH) protocol plays a crucial role in this setup by providing encrypted communication between the user and the Raspberry Pi device. SSH not only ensures data confidentiality but also authenticates both the client and server during each session. When combined with RemoteIoT's VPC infrastructure, SSH creates a robust framework for secure remote management of Raspberry Pi devices.

    Configuring SSH on Raspberry Pi

    Configuring SSH on a Raspberry Pi involves several crucial steps to ensure secure remote access. The process begins with enabling the SSH service through the Raspberry Pi configuration tool or by creating an empty file named "ssh" in the boot partition. Once enabled, the SSH daemon must be properly configured to meet security best practices.

    Key configuration elements include setting up key-based authentication, disabling password authentication, and configuring firewall rules to restrict SSH access. The SSH configuration file, typically located at /etc/ssh/sshd_config, contains various parameters that can be adjusted to enhance security. These include port number specification, login restrictions, and connection timeout settings.

    Regular maintenance of SSH configurations is essential for maintaining security. This includes periodic key rotation, monitoring authentication logs, and keeping the SSH software up to date. Additionally, implementing fail2ban or similar intrusion prevention systems can help protect against brute-force attacks and unauthorized access attempts.

    Troubleshooting Common Issues

    Despite careful planning and implementation, users may encounter various issues when working with RemoteIoT VPC SSH and Raspberry Pi devices. One common problem is connection timeouts, often caused by network configuration errors or firewall rules blocking necessary ports. Verifying security group settings and route tables typically resolves these issues.

    Authentication failures frequently occur due to mismatched SSH keys or expired certificates. Regular key rotation and certificate management practices help prevent these issues. Additionally, time synchronization problems between devices can cause authentication failures, emphasizing the importance of maintaining accurate system clocks across all devices.

    Performance issues may arise from resource constraints on Raspberry Pi devices or network bandwidth limitations. Monitoring system resources and network utilization helps identify bottlenecks. Implementing load balancing and resource optimization techniques can improve overall system performance and reliability.
